Как софтверные решения осуществляют тестирование соответствия

Как софтверные решения осуществляют тестирование соответствия

Нынешняя создание софта невозможна без комплексной структуры проверки качества. Каждый период миллионы пользователей контактируют с разнообразными программами, онлайн-решениями и программными продуктами, предполагая от них бесперебойной функциональности, безопасности и соответствия описанному опциям. Методология гарантирования надежности цифровых продуктов являет собой многоступенчатую методологию тестирования, тестирования и контроля, которая обеспечивает разработку на всех фазах его существования.

Что именно определяют надежностью в цифровых разработках

Надежность ПО Адмирал Х определяется совокупностью критериев, которые в целом создают потребительский опыт и технологическую надежность продукта. Работоспособность остается основополагающим критерием – система обязана выполнять все указанные возможности в соответственности с технологическими условиями и надеждами юзеров.

Стабильность цифрового решения проявляется в его умении действовать без сбоев в многочисленных обстоятельствах использования. Это содержит сопротивляемость к непредвиденным информации, адекватную управление неверных обстоятельств и умение восстанавливаться после краткосрочных неполадок. Быстродействие определяет темп выполнения действий, время реакции приложения на потребительские действия и результативность применения технических ресурсов.

Удобство применения показывает, как логичным и комфортным является контакт с приложением для финальных пользователей. Туда входят эргономичность взаимодействия Адмирал Казино, понятность управления, доступность для граждан с специальными потребностями и всеобщая легкость изучения возможностей.

Обслуживаемость технического кода влияет на способность его дальнейшего развития и обслуживания. Качественно разработанный код должен быть понятным, организованным, качественно оформленным и организованным подобным способом, чтобы прочие кодеры смогли просто в нем разобраться и включить необходимые модификации.

Каким образом тестируют, что всё работает по спецификациям

Контроль соответствия технического разработки спецификациям стартует с скрупулезного анализа спецификаций и функциональных условий. Отдел контроля формирует развернутые сценарии, которые включают все представленные в материалах сценарии применения программы Адмирал Х. Любой случай включает определенные действия для воспроизведения, предполагаемые выводы и критерии успешного выполнения проверки.

Матрица отслеживаемости условий содействует убедиться, что каждое спецификация охвачено релевантными проверками, а всякий тест ассоциирован с конкретным параметром. Это позволяет исключить обстоятельств, когда критически важная возможности оказывается непроверенной или когда расходуется период на тестирование несуществующих спецификаций.

Заключительное испытание проводится с участием заказчиков или участников отделов, которые наиболее точно знают, как программа должна работать в действительных ситуациях. Они проверяют не только технологическую правильность реализации, но и согласованность деловым операциям и потребительским ожиданиям.

Повторное испытание подтверждает, что недавние корректировки в системе не нарушили предварительно функционировавший опции. После каждого обновления или исправления дефектов стартует комплект проверок, тестирующих главные операции приложения.

Почему тестирование стартует еще до создания скрипта

Актуальный способ к обеспечению стандартов предполагает деятельное привлечение специалистов по проверке на первоначальных этапах программы:

  • Исследование спецификаций дает возможность найти погрешности, противоречия и упущения в системных условиях до инициирования программирования.
  • Создание проверочных сценариев содействует качественнее осознать предполагаемое функционирование системы и детализировать нюансы реализации.
  • Подготовка контрольных материалов и проверочной базы сберегает время на последующих фазах.
  • Составление методологии тестирования определяет требуемые ресурсы и временные рамки для надежной тестирования.
  • Формирование программных проверок может начинаться одновременно с разработкой центрального программы.

Такой подход, известный как “сдвиг влево” в проверке, значительно снижает цену устранения багов, так как их выявление и исправление на ранних стадиях предполагает меньших вложений времени и средств. Кроме того, начальное включение экспертов в процесс помогает формированию совместного восприятия проекта у целой группы создания Admiral X.

Что за виды проверок применяют: мануально и автоматически

Мануальное проверка остается незаменимым инструментом для контроля потребительского опыта, экспериментального тестирования и проверки комплексных деловых случаев. Специалисты исполняют задачу финальных пользователей, взаимодействуя с системой через графический интерфейс и изучая простоту использования, разумность деятельности и согласованность ожиданиям.

Исследовательское проверка обеспечивает найти непредвиденные дефекты и сложности, которые не были учтены в официальных проверках. Опытные тестировщики применяют свое знание предметной области и профессиональную ощущение для выявления возможных слабых мест в системе.

Автоматизированное испытание эффективно для контроля регулярных вариантов, регрессионного проверки и проверки значительных количеств информации. Механизированные проверки могут запускаться непрерывно, не нуждаются вовлечения человека и предоставляют надежные результаты проверки.

Единичное испытание тестирует индивидуальные части программы Адмирал Х в отдельности от прочей программы. Программисты разрабатывают испытания для своего кода, которые выполняются при любом корректировке и содействуют моментально обнаруживать сложности на стадии индивидуальных функций или групп.

Интеграционное проверка фокусируется на контроле связи между разнообразными модулями и компонентами программы. Оно помогает выявить проблемы в взаимодействиях, транспортировке данных между компонентами и всеобщей структуре разработки.

Каким образом обнаруживают ошибки на отличающихся стадиях разработки

На этапе планирования и разработки неточности находятся через просмотр технологических требований, изучение архитектурных вариантов и моделирование клиентских случаев. Профессионалы отличающихся специализаций изучают материалы, выявляют вероятные проблемы и советуют улучшения до инициирования интенсивной программирования.

Во период создания кода программисты используют фиксированный изучение программирования, который механически тестирует систему Admiral X на соответствие стандартам кодирования, вероятные проблемы защиты и стандартные неточности программирования. Актуальные совмещенные среды программирования содержат инструменты, которые выделяют проблемы непосредственно в процессе разработки программы.

Анализ программы представляет собой процедуру коллективной контроля программы кодерами. Сотрудники исследуют созданный программу с позиции разумности деятельности, совместимости правилам команды, возможных проблем быстродействия и возможностей для оптимизации. Этот процесс не только помогает выявить баги, но и помогает распространению опытом в группе.

Активное испытание исполняется на действующей системе и включает разнообразные разновидности рабочего и вспомогательного проверки. Тестировщики стартуют приложение с разными информацией, контролируют функционирование в предельных условиях и изучают результаты исполнения.

Почему важно контролировать безопасность и защиту данных

Защищенность технических продуктов Адмирал Х является критически важным элементом качества в время автоматизации и увеличивающихся киберугроз. Взломы секьюрности могут повлечь не только к экономическим ущербу, но и к значительному ущербу престижу организации, потере уверенности заказчиков и юридическим результатам.

Тестирование безопасности содержит проверку аутентификации и авторизации клиентов, охраны от основных разновидностей нападений, вроде вставки кода, XSS и фальсификация межсайтовых запросов. Профессионалы по безопасности исследуют структуру приложения с перспективы возможных рисков и контролируют действенность реализованных охранных способов.

Оборона индивидуальных сведений требует специального сосредоточенности в связи с ужесточением правовых норм в направлении секретности. Системы должны правильно управлять, хранить и пересылать конфиденциальную данные, предоставлять возможность уничтожения материалов по запросу пользователей и соблюдать основы минимизации накопления информации.

Кодировочная охрана данных Адмирал Казино контролируется на вопрос использования новейших методов кодирования, адекватной воплощения правил безопасности и адекватного регулирования ключами. Уязвимости в шифровании могут сделать всю механизм обороны неэффективной.

Какими методами тестируют быстроту, нагружение и устойчивость

Быстродействие ПО проверяется через набор нагрузочных тестов, которые воспроизводят многочисленные сценарии применения приложения в действительных ситуациях. Загрузочное испытание устанавливает, как программа работает при ожидаемом числе пользователей и действий.

Предельное испытание помогает обнаружить момент сбоя приложения, поэтапно наращивая напряжение до критических параметров. Это дает возможность понять пределы возможностей приложения и проверить, в какой степени правильно она снижается при чрезмерной нагрузке.

Проверка устойчивости включает продолжительные проверки деятельности приложения Admiral X под непрерывной загрузкой для нахождения потерь данных, постепенного снижения производительности и других неполадок, которые выражаются только при длительной деятельности.

Наблюдение производительности во время контроля содержит контроль использования центрального процессора, памяти, хранилища и коммуникационных возможностей. Эти показатели помогают обнаружить ограничения в архитектуре и улучшить производительность программы.

Что выполняют, если баг найдена перед релизом

Обнаружение бага перед запуском разработки инициирует ход оценки критичности сложности и принятия решения о будущих мерах. Серьезные дефекты, которые могут вызвать к утрате данных, взлому защиты или тотальной неисправности системы, предполагают немедленного устранения.

Методология контроля ошибками охватывает развернутое оформление обнаруженной неполадки с указанием действий для повторения, условий, в котором проявляется баг, и ожидаемого поведения системы. Команда создания исследует дефект, определяет основание и проектирует исправление.

Приоритизация исправлений базируется на воздействии ошибки на юзеров Адмирал Казино, периодичности ее демонстрации и сложности устранения. Определенные незначительные неполадки могут быть отложены до следующего запуска, если их коррекция требует серьезных модификаций в коде.

После коррекции ошибки проводится проверочное тестирование, которое подтверждает, что проблема ликвидирована, а также повторное проверка для проверки того, что коррекция не повлекло к возникновению свежих ошибок в других элементах приложения.